Ultra Lightweight Self Propelled Wheelchair

Self-propelled wheelchairs that are lightweight allow you to move with confidence and ease giving you freedom and autonomy. Ideal for use all day long they reduce stress on both the caregiver and the user.

It is crucial to select an office chair that has seating components that are lightweight and meet the postural needs of the client.

Comfort

The unique design of our ultra lightweight wheelchairs provides users with superior comfort, which helps to lessen the strain on their bodies and caregivers. The features include footrests that move and can be folded up or swung out of the way to make it safer and easier transfers into and out of the chair. The ergonomically designed seat provides support and posture, while the soft-touch fabric panels on the side panels offer an easy grip. You can also personalize your wheelchair by selecting from a range of upholstery colours that suit your style and personality.

A wheelchair can be a useful mobility aid that allows you to live independently and continue enjoying many of your most loved activities. However, it's important to choose the appropriate model to match your unique needs. If you're unsure of the options we are here to assist you.

Wheelchairs come in many sizes to meet your requirements and are constructed of durable materials for long-lasting performance. Generally, a basic wheelchair is best for people weighing up to 300 pounds. It gives you the option of being self-propelled when your energy levels are high and driven by an attendant if they're low.

Standard wheelchairs come with two large rear wheels and four smaller front wheels. These wheels are used for stability and steering. These wheelchairs are difficult to push and can be a strain for both the caregiver and user. They are therefore best suitable for short-term and travel purposes.

The lightweight wheelchairs are made from lighter materials such as aluminum. They are also more maneuverable than heavier models. This makes them easier to push by caregivers and users. They can also be folded and transported in vehicles. This makes them an ideal choice for use on the go or in everyday life.

The lightweight frame for the wheelchair makes it easier to get into and out of the chair. This can eliminate a common frustration for many. There are also features that allow users to more easily use the wheelchair, including adjustable brake controls and an easy-to-use height adjustment for the seat.

Mobility

Our Ultra lightweight wheelchair comes equipped with several features that make it easy to move and transport. The front wheels can be raised by a caregiver using two stepper tubes. Long reach brakes on the rear tyres can be easily activated by a user or caretaker to decrease speed and allow for a more stable parking. The 20cm (8") solid Polyurethane (PU), front tyres allow for easy maneuverability on various surfaces. They are durable and low maintenance.

Our research has revealed that the new ultra-lightweight rigid frames offer superior propulsion efficiency when compared to folding frame wheelchairs when measured against concrete and carpet. The performance of a wheelchair can be affected by its components such as the casters, tires, and its environment. The environment of a wheelchair can cause vibrational forces, impact loads and inertial torques during use which are not captured in the current tests of failure for wheelchairs [1010.

Real-world mobility is defined by slow, short bursts of wheeling that are punctuated by stops, starts and turning maneuvers. This type of mobility is typically not evident in current tests of wheelchair failures, since it is rarely done on the same surface over the same time. We equipped a convenience sample with a seat switch to determine the occupancy of the occupant and an accelerometer to track their daily movement.

The results of this study revealed that the majority of participants rode only 1.7 km per day, and fast (>1 milliseconds) and lengthy (>2 minutes) bouts were uncommon. This study reinforces the need to focus on maneuverability in wheelchair prescription and training.

The results also showed that a wheelchair could improve its overall efficiency by using lighter tires and frames, but that further weight reductions will not improve the efficiency of its propulsion significantly. self propelled all terrain wheelchair is because weight adds the metabolic cost of the frame due to flexion and vibration, and the relative motion of the removable loosely-attached parts such as footrests. The addition of 5 kg to the frame's mass does not significantly alter its energetic performance when measured against concrete.

Easy of Use


The convenience of using an ultra lightweight self propelled wheelchair is a key element in its appeal. Relying on others to get your places can be very difficult for many wheelchair users and being able to go wherever you want and whenever you want is essential to keep your independence. You can go shopping and visit your friends or engage in your passions and hobbies without requiring someone else to drive you.

One of the most important aspects in determining how easy it is to push a wheelchair is its wheel size. The size of the wheel is a key factor in determining how easy it is to push a wheelchair. The smaller front wheels are simpler to push compared to the larger rear wheels, because they require less effort to push the same distance.

People who choose lightweight wheelchairs benefit from these advantages as they are more maneuverable, which means you can maneuver in tight spaces and make sharp turns more easily. This allows you to navigate bridges, kerbs and other obstacles that would normally pose a problem for standard wheelchairs. This allows you to gain access to areas of your home or community previously inaccessible, such as cobbled or grassy surfaces.

You should also think about whether you intend to use the wheelchair alone or with an assistant. Spinlife recommends the Basic or Lightweight Wheelchair in case you intend to make use of it for long periods without requiring an attendant. If you plan to rely on an attendant to help you, we suggest that you look at the features of a Transport Chair or our Heavy Duty models.

Our lightweight self-propelled wheelchairs can be folded down and removed easily making them much easier to store, transport or clean. They can be carried in the car's boot and are an excellent option for those who have to travel long distances as they can be easily carried into restaurants and hotels. The chairs come with footrests that can be turned or moved to help you get into and out.

Customisation

While most wheelchairs have standard features, there are a variety of options available to help adapt them to each user's preferences. For instance, some models have removable footrests that fold down or swung out of the way, making for more secure and easy transfers into and out of the chair. Some models also come with a variety of armrest and seat configurations, which help to lessen stress on shoulders.

Another option is to look at wheelchairs that have suspension. This is particularly crucial for those who spend a lot of time in their wheelchair. It will reduce the vibrations transmitted through the frame which may cause discomfort. This also makes it more sturdy and able to handle different types of terrain.

Wheelchairs that have suspension can also cut down on the effort needed to propel them. They are more efficient in transferring the energy of the wheels into forward motion. This reduces stress for both the person using the wheelchair and their caregiver especially when they have to push the chair for long distances or up steep slopes.

Lightweight and ultra-lightweight manual wheelchairs are cheaper than conventional counterparts, which means they are perfect for those who are on a tight budget. However, it is still crucial to consult with a healthcare professional, as they can suggest the best wheelchair for your particular needs.

Ultralight, light and lightweight manual wheelchairs fall under the category of Complex Rehab equipment, which means they are usually recommended by a Healthcare Professional with ATP (Assistive Technology Practitioner) accreditation. They will be able evaluate your requirements, recommend suitable equipment, and submit all paperwork needed to secure funding approval for a new wheelchair. After your wheelchair is ordered and delivered, it can be brought to your home to use immediately.
